谷歌浏览器

首页 帮助中心

Chrome浏览器多语言切换操作优化实测报告

时间:2025-10-20 959 来源:谷歌浏览器官网
正文介绍

Chrome浏览器多语言切换操作优化实测报告1

标题:Chrome浏览器多语言切换操作优化实测报告
1. 引言
随着全球化的深入发展和互联网内容的多元化,用户对浏览器的需求日益增长,特别是对于多语言支持的需求。Chrome浏览器作为全球广泛使用的网络浏览工具,其多语言切换功能对于满足不同地区用户的访问需求至关重要。然而,在实际使用过程中,用户可能会遇到一系列问题,如频繁的语言切换、界面不友好、响应速度慢等,这些问题不仅影响用户体验,也可能导致用户流失。因此,本报告旨在通过实际测试和分析,评估Chrome浏览器多语言切换功能的当前表现,并提出针对性的优化建议。
本报告将详细介绍测试的背景、目的、方法和结果,以及针对发现的问题所提出的优化措施。我们将重点关注用户在多语言切换过程中的操作流程、遇到的挑战以及系统的性能表现。此外,报告还将探讨如何通过技术手段提高多语言切换的效率和准确性,以及如何增强用户界面的直观性和易用性。通过这些分析和建议,我们期望能够为Chrome浏览器的多语言切换功能提供实质性的改进,从而提升整体的用户满意度和市场竞争力。
2. 测试背景与目标
2.1 测试背景
在全球化的背景下,多语言支持已成为现代浏览器不可或缺的一部分。Chrome浏览器凭借其广泛的用户基础和强大的市场占有率,成为了多语言支持测试的理想平台。然而,随着用户需求的多样化和国际化趋势的加强,Chrome浏览器面临着如何在保持高效性能的同时,提供流畅且直观的多语言切换体验的挑战。用户期待能够在一个界面中轻松切换到多种语言,而无需频繁地重新加载页面或进行复杂的操作。此外,随着网络环境的复杂化,多语言切换的准确性和速度也成为衡量浏览器性能的重要指标。因此,本次测试的背景是探索Chrome浏览器在多语言切换方面的性能瓶颈,以及如何通过优化来提升用户体验。
2.2 测试目标
本次测试的主要目标是评估Chrome浏览器多语言切换功能的实际表现,并识别出存在的问题。具体而言,测试将关注以下几个方面:
- 用户界面的直观性和易用性:包括语言选择器的布局是否合理,切换按钮的位置是否便于操作,以及整个切换过程是否流畅无阻。
- 语言切换的准确性:测试将模拟不同的语言环境,检查浏览器是否能准确识别并显示正确的语言选项。
- 性能表现:评估在多语言切换过程中,浏览器的响应速度和资源消耗情况,特别是在高负载情况下的表现。
- 兼容性和稳定性:确保在不同操作系统版本、不同硬件配置下,多语言切换功能都能正常工作,无明显的兼容性问题。
3. 测试方法与过程
3.1 测试环境设置
为了确保测试结果的准确性和可靠性,我们搭建了一个模拟真实使用场景的测试环境。该环境包括了多个操作系统版本(Windows 10, macOS Big Sur, Linux Ubuntu 20.04),以覆盖更广泛的用户群体。硬件方面,我们使用了从入门级到高端的多种配置,包括配备了不同类型处理器(Intel Core i5, i7, i9)和显卡(NVIDIA GeForce GTX 1650, RTX 3080 Ti)的设备。此外,我们还模拟了来自不同国家和地区的网络环境,包括高速宽带、4G/5G移动网络以及Wi-Fi信号,以测试多语言切换在不同网络条件下的性能。
3.2 测试步骤
测试过程分为以下几个步骤:
- 语言选择器测试:首先,我们观察用户如何通过语言选择器选择所需的语言。这一步骤是为了评估语言选择器的设计是否直观易用。
- 切换按钮响应时间:接着,我们记录用户点击切换按钮后,浏览器响应的时间延迟。这有助于了解切换过程的速度。
- 多语言环境下的切换准确性:在不同的语言环境中,我们尝试切换到其他语言,并验证是否正确显示了相应的语言选项。这一步骤是为了评估语言切换的准确性。
- 性能测试:在高负载情况下,我们模拟大量用户同时进行多语言切换操作,以测试浏览器的性能表现。这包括了启动时间、加载页面的速度以及在切换过程中的资源消耗。
- 兼容性测试:最后,我们在不同的操作系统和硬件配置下运行测试,以确保多语言切换功能在所有平台上都能正常工作。
4. 测试结果
4.1 用户操作流程
在测试过程中,我们对用户的操作流程进行了详细的观察和记录。用户首先打开Chrome浏览器,并进入一个包含多种语言选项的网站。他们可以通过点击浏览器右上角的语言图标或使用快捷键“Ctrl+Shift+L”来选择新的语言。一旦选择了新语言,用户通常需要等待几秒钟,直到页面完全加载并准备好显示新语言的内容。在这个过程中,用户可能会遇到页面加载缓慢的情况,尤其是在网络连接不稳定时。此外,一些用户可能会在切换语言时遇到界面卡顿或响应延迟的问题。
4.2 性能数据
性能测试结果显示,在低至中等负载的情况下,Chrome浏览器的多语言切换功能表现出色。然而,在高负载情况下,尤其是当用户同时进行多项操作时,如同时切换多个语言标签页或执行复杂的网页操作,浏览器的性能会明显下降。例如,在模拟的多用户在线会议场景中,我们发现平均响应时间从正常负载下的XX秒增加到XX秒以上。此外,随着语言数量的增加,页面加载时间也会相应增加,导致整体性能下降。
4.3 问题汇总
在测试过程中,我们发现了一些问题和不足之处。首先,虽然大多数用户能够顺利地进行多语言切换,但仍有部分用户反映界面卡顿和响应延迟的问题。其次,在某些特定情况下,如网络环境不稳定或设备性能较低时,多语言切换的准确性和速度会受到影响。此外,我们还注意到,尽管大部分用户能够理解并接受当前的多语言切换功能,但仍有少数用户提出了改进建议,希望浏览器能够提供更加直观和流畅的用户体验。
5. 问题分析
5.1 界面卡顿原因
经过深入分析,我们发现界面卡顿的主要原因在于多线程处理机制的局限性。在高负载情况下,浏览器需要同时处理多个请求和响应,这导致了界面资源的争用和延迟。具体来说,当用户切换语言时,浏览器需要更新界面元素以反映新的语言设置,这个过程涉及到大量的DOM操作和事件处理。由于这些操作需要在后台线程中进行,而前台线程可能正在进行其他任务,这就导致了界面的短暂停滞。此外,如果网络条件不佳或设备性能有限,这种卡顿现象会更加明显。
5.2 响应延迟原因
响应延迟问题主要是由于多语言切换过程中的数据传输和处理延迟所致。当用户尝试切换到另一种语言时,浏览器需要向服务器发送请求以获取新的语言内容,然后处理这些内容并将其显示在页面上。这个过程中涉及的数据量较大,且需要通过网络传输到用户的设备上,因此存在一定的延迟。特别是在网络带宽受限或服务器响应较慢的情况下,这种延迟会更加显著。此外,如果用户同时进行多项操作(如滚动页面、点击链接等),这也会增加浏览器的处理负担,进一步延长响应时间。
5.3 性能瓶颈分析
性能瓶颈的分析揭示了几个关键因素。首先是内存管理问题,当用户切换到不同的语言时,浏览器需要保存新的语言状态信息并在内存中进行处理。如果内存资源不足或分配不当,就会导致内存泄漏或过度分配,进而影响性能。其次是渲染效率问题,多语言切换涉及到大量的DOM操作和样式调整,这些操作需要在短时间内完成才能保证流畅的用户体验。如果渲染引擎无法有效地处理这些请求,就会导致页面渲染速度下降。最后,还有缓存策略的影响,如果浏览器未能及时更新缓存中的旧内容,或者缓存策略过于严格导致频繁清除缓存,都会影响多语言切换的性能。
6. 优化建议
6.1 界面优化建议
为了解决界面卡顿问题,我们建议优化界面设计,减少不必要的DOM操作。可以通过引入更高效的布局算法和减少重绘次数来实现这一点。此外,建议使用异步JavaScript框架(如Vue.js或React)来改善组件间的通信,从而减少主线程的负担。还可以考虑使用Web Workers来处理后台任务,这样前台线程就可以专注于用户交互。对于响应延迟问题,建议优化数据传输机制,例如使用WebSockets实现实时双向通信,以减少服务器请求次数和提高数据传输效率。同时,可以考虑使用CDN服务来加速静态资源的加载速度。
6.2 性能优化建议
针对性能瓶颈,我们提出以下优化措施:首先,优化内存管理策略,确保合理分配内存资源,避免内存泄漏。可以通过限制最大打开窗口数和使用智能内存回收技术来实现这一点。其次,提高渲染效率,可以通过使用CSS预处理器(如Sass或Less)来编写更高效的CSS代码,减少不必要的计算和重排。还可以利用浏览器的开发者工具来监控和优化渲染性能。最后,优化缓存策略,可以采用渐进式Web应用(PWA)技术来强制浏览器清理过期的缓存内容,或者使用Service Workers来监听缓存变化并自动更新页面内容。
6.3 用户体验改进
为了提升用户体验,我们建议实施以下改进措施:简化语言切换流程,通过提供清晰的指示和反馈来帮助用户更快地找到所需语言。例如,可以在语言选择器旁边添加一个明显的提示按钮,引导用户进行语言切换。此外,可以提供个性化的语言建议和推荐,根据用户的浏览历史和偏好来推荐合适的语言选项。还可以考虑引入语音识别功能,允许用户通过语音命令来快速切换语言。最后,定期收集用户反馈并根据他们的建议不断优化产品,这将有助于持续提升用户满意度和忠诚度。
7. 结论
7.1 总结
本次测试和分析揭示了Chrome浏览器多语言切换功能在实际使用中存在的若干问题。这些问题主要集中在界面卡顿、响应延迟以及性能瓶颈等方面。通过对这些问题的深入分析,我们提出了一系列优化建议,旨在提高用户界面的直观性和易用性,优化性能表现,并改进用户体验。这些建议涵盖了界面优化、性能优化以及用户体验改进等多个方面,旨在全面提升Chrome浏览器多语言切换功能的整体性能和用户满意度。
7.2 未来展望
展望未来,我们期待Chrome浏览器能够持续改进其多语言切换功能,以满足日益增长的国际化需求。随着技术的不断发展和用户需求的不断变化,我们相信Chrome浏览器将能够提供更加流畅、高效且直观的多语言切换体验。我们将继续关注相关技术的发展动态,积极探索新的解决方案,以确保Chrome浏览器能够满足全球用户的需求,成为他们最信赖的多语言切换工具。
TOP